Forrester Research Retained Earnings (Accumulated Deficit) 2010-2024 | FORR

Forrester Research retained earnings (accumulated deficit) from 2010 to 2024. Retained earnings (accumulated deficit) can be defined as profits reinvested in the corporation after dividends have been paid out.
Forrester Research Annual Retained Earnings (Accumulated Deficit)
(Millions of US $)
2023 $178
2022 $175
2021 $153
2020 $128
2019 $118
2018 $128
2017 $123
2016 $122
2015 $117
2014 $117
2013 $118
2012 $118
2011 $105
2010 $82
2009 $130
Forrester Research Quarterly Retained Earnings (Accumulated Deficit)
(Millions of US $)
2024-09-30 $172
2024-06-30 $177
2024-03-31 $171
2023-12-31 $178
2023-09-30 $178
2023-06-30 $176
2023-03-31 $171
2022-12-31 $175
2022-09-30 $176
2022-06-30 $171
2022-03-31 $157
2021-12-31 $153
2021-09-30 $145
2021-06-30 $140
2021-03-31 $132
2020-12-31 $128
2020-09-30 $126
2020-06-30 $129
2020-03-31 $117
2019-12-31 $118
2019-09-30 $113
2019-06-30 $116
2019-03-31 $114
2018-12-31 $128
2018-09-30 $126
2018-06-30 $126
2018-03-31 $121
2017-12-31 $123
2017-09-30 $124
2017-06-30 $124
2017-03-31 $121
2016-12-31 $122
2016-09-30 $119
2016-06-30 $119
2016-03-31 $115
2015-12-31 $117
2015-09-30 $118
2015-06-30 $117
2015-03-31 $114
2014-12-31 $117
2014-09-30 $117
2014-06-30 $117
2014-03-31 $115
2013-12-31 $118
2013-09-30 $119
2013-06-30 $119
2013-03-31 $117
2012-12-31 $118
2012-09-30 $117
2012-06-30 $109
2012-03-31 $105
2011-12-31 $105
2011-09-30 $96
2011-06-30 $90
2011-03-31 $85
2010-12-31 $82
2010-09-30 $146
2010-06-30 $142
2010-03-31 $135
2009-12-31 $130
2009-09-30 $124
2009-06-30 $119
2009-03-31 $113
Sector Industry Market Cap Revenue
Computer and Technology Computer - Services $0.318B $0.481B
Forrester Research, Inc. is a global research and advisory firm serving professionals in 13 key roles across three distinct client segments. Their clients face progressively complex business and technology decisions every day. To help them understand, strategize, and act upon opportunities brought by change, Forrester provides proprietary research, consumer and business data, custom consulting, events and online communities, and peer-to-peer executive programs. They guide leaders in business technology, marketing and strategy, and the technology industry through independent fact-based insight, ensuring their business success today and tomorrow.
Stock Name Country Market Cap PE Ratio
CGI (GIB) Canada $25.519B 19.96
CACI (CACI) United States $10.655B 21.00
CSG Systems (CSGS) United States $1.606B 17.47
Innodata (INOD) United States $1.341B 107.51
Formula Systems (1985) (FORTY) Israel $1.267B 17.16
PDF Solutions (PDFS) United States $1.194B 153.95
Cass Information Systems (CASS) United States $0.601B 26.69